Digital Convergence at SXSW 2006

Every year, as part of the SXSW Film panels (March 11-14), we team up with the SXSW Interactive Conference for a series of joint sessions. This allows attendees to witness the true crossover potential between the worlds of filmmaking and new media. For SXSW 2006, we're getting some assistance from the folks at the Digital Convergence Initiative, who have helped put together an impressive lineup for SXSW Film and Interactive registrants.

The panel topics include:

Cyberplace: Online in Offline Spaces and Vice Versa

Venture Capital vs. Credit Cards: Funding Strategies for Digital Convergence Businesses

Serious Games for Learning

The Future of Darknets: Can Hollywood See the Light?

How to develop for Personal Devices
